CWC Interiors Business Review
5666 South 122nd East Avenue, Tulsa OK 74146
918-250-0025
  • Log In

CWC Interiors

  • Log In
Logo
  • Home
  • About
  • Contact
  • Reviews
  • 5666 South 122nd East Avenue, Tulsa OK 74146
  • 918-250-0025
Call
  1. Home
  2. Contact
  3. Directions
CWC Interiors

©    |  Privacy Policy

  • 5666 South 122nd East Avenue
    Tulsa OK 74146
  • 918-250-0025

6,549Visitors

Zip2Biz.com | Log In | Report Problem | Advertise | Web Design
The Best Flooring Stores near Tulsa, OK